KidZania Delhi NCR – A Mini City for Kids

5

KidZania Delhi NCR

Overview

KidZania is an indoor role-play city where children act like adults. Kids can become pilots, doctors, firefighters, or bankers while learning teamwork and money management.

Highlights

  • 100+ real-life activities
  • Earn KidZos (KidZania currency)
  • Professional role-play zones

Cost (Approx)

  • Kids (4–14 yrs): ₹900–₹1500
  • Adults: ₹400–₹600

Location

Noida, Delhi NCR

Timings

10:00 AM – 8:00 PM


National Science Centre – Learn Through Fun

National Science Centre

Overview

One of the best things to see in Delhi, this science museum turns learning into play with interactive exhibits and outdoor science activities.

Highlights

  • Hands-on experiments
  • Dinosaur gallery
  • Space & energy sections
  • Outdoor science park

Cost

  • Adults: ₹70
  • Children: ₹30

Location

Pragati Maidan, New Delhi

Timings

10:00 AM – 6:00 PM


National Rail Museum – Trains, Toy Rides & History

National Rail Museum Delhi

Overview

The National Rail Museum showcases India’s railway heritage with real-size trains including the famous Fairy Queen steam locomotive.

Highlights

  • Toy Train Ride
  • Indoor & outdoor exhibits
  • Simulator rides
  • Vintage locomotives

Cost

  • Adults: ₹50
  • Children (3–12 yrs): ₹10
  • Toy Train: ₹20 per person

Location

Chanakyapuri, New Delhi

Timings

10:00 AM – 5:00 PM
Closed Mondays & national holidays


Nehru Planetarium – Space Learning for Curious Minds

Nehru Planetarium Delhi

Overview

Perfect for young explorers, this planetarium offers space shows and astronomy exhibits.

Highlights

  • Sky theatre shows
  • Interactive models
  • Space learning sessions

Cost

  • Adults: ₹100
  • Children: ₹60

Location

Teen Murti Bhavan

Timings

10:30 AM – 5:00 PM


Delhi Zoo – Wildlife Experience

National Zoological Park Delhi

Overview

A classic family attraction where kids see lions, tigers, giraffes and birds.

Highlights

  • Battery-operated rides
  • Large animal enclosures
  • Picnic areas

Cost

  • Adults: ₹80
  • Children: ₹40

Location

Mathura Road

Timings

9:00 AM – 4:30 PM (Closed Fridays)
